CVE-2012-0151
Microsoft Windows Authenticode Signature Verification Remote Code Execution Vulnerability
⚠ KEVEPSS 88.8%
Description
The Authenticode Signature Verification function in Microsoft Windows (WinVerifyTrust) does not properly validate the digest of a signed portable executable (PE) file,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ute code.

Is CVE-2012-0151 being exploited?
Yes — CVE-2012-0151 is on the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og. Patch immediately.
